+.. code-block:: cmake
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 target_sources(<target>
|
|
|
+ <INTERFACE|PUBLIC|PRIVATE> [FILE_SET set1] [TYPE type1] [BASE_DIRS dirs1...] [FILES files1...]
|
|
|
+ [<INTERFACE|PUBLIC|PRIVATE> [FILE_SET set2] [TYPE type2] [BASE_DIRS dirs2...] [FILES files2...])
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+Adds a file set to a target, or adds files to an existing file set. Targets
|
|
|
+have zero or more named file sets. Each file set has a name, a type, a scope of
|
|
|
+``INTERFACE``, ``PUBLIC``, or ``PRIVATE``, one or more base directories, and
|
|
|
+files within those directories. The only acceptable type is ``HEADERS``. The
|
|
|
+optional default file sets are named after their type.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+Files in a ``PRIVATE`` or ``PUBLIC`` file set are marked as source files for
|
|
|
+the purposes of IDE integration. Additionally, files in ``HEADERS`` file sets
|
|
|
+have their :prop_sf:`HEADER_FILE_ONLY` property set to ``TRUE``. Files in an
|
|
|
+``INTERFACE`` or ``PUBLIC`` file set can be installed with the
|
|
|
+:command:`install(TARGETS)` command, and exported with the
|
|
|
+:command:`install(EXPORT)` and :command:`export` commands.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+Each ``target_sources(FILE_SET)`` entry starts with ``INTERFACE``, ``PUBLIC``, or
|
|
|
+``PRIVATE`` and accepts the following arguments:
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+``FILE_SET <set>``
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 A string representing the name of the file set to create or add to. This must
|
|
|
+ not start with a capital letter, unless its name is ``HEADERS``.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+``TYPE <type>``
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 A string representing the type of the file set. The only acceptable value is
|
|
|
+ ``HEADERS``. This may be omitted if the name of the file set is ``HEADERS``.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+``BASE_DIRS <dirs>``
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 An optional list of strings representing the base directories of the file
|
|
|
+ set. This argument supports
|
|
|
+ :manual:`generator expressions <cmake-generator-expressions(7)>`. No two
|
|
|
+ ``BASE_DIRS`` may be sub-directories of each other. If no ``BASE_DIRS`` are
|
|
|
+ specified when the file set is first created, the value of
|
|
|
+ :variable:`CMAKE_CURRENT_SOURCE_DIR` is added.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+``FILES <files>``
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 An optional list of strings representing files in the file set. Each file
|
|
|
+ must be in one of the ``BASE_DIRS``. This argument supports
|
|
|
+ :manual:`generator expressions <cmake-generator-expressions(7)>`. If relative
|
|
|
+ paths are specified, they are considered relative to
|
|
|
+ :variable:`CMAKE_CURRENT_SOURCE_DIR` at the time ``target_sources()`` is
|
|
|
+ called, unless they start with ``$<``, in which case they are computed
|
|
|
+ relative to the target's source directory after genex evaluation.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+The following target properties are set by ``target_sources(FILE_SET)``:
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+:prop_tgt:`HEADER_SETS`
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 List of ``PRIVATE`` and ``PUBLIC`` header sets associated with a target.
|
|
|
+ Headers listed in these header sets are treated as source files for the
|
|
|
+ purposes of IDE integration, and have their :prop_sf:`HEADER_FILE_ONLY`
|
|
|
+ property set to ``TRUE``.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+:prop_tgt:`INTERFACE_HEADER_SETS`
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 List of ``INTERFACE`` and ``PUBLIC`` header sets associated with a target.
|
|
|
+ Headers listed in these header sets can be installed with
|
|
|
+ :command:`install(TARGETS)` and exported with :command:`install(EXPORT)` and
|
|
|
+ :command:`export`.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+:prop_tgt:`HEADER_SET`
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 Headers in the default header set associated with a target. This property
|
|
|
+ supports :manual:`generator expressions <cmake-generator-expressions(7)>`.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+:prop_tgt:`HEADER_SET_<NAME>`
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 Headers in the named header set ``<NAME>`` associated with a target. This
|
|
|
+ property supports
|
|
|
+ :manual:`generator expressions <cmake-generator-expressions(7)>`.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+:prop_tgt:`HEADER_DIRS`
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 Base directories of the default header set associated with a target. This
|
|
|
+ property supports
|
|
|
+ :manual:`generator expressions <cmake-generator-expressions(7)>`.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+:prop_tgt:`HEADER_DIRS_<NAME>`
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 Base directories of the header set ``<NAME>`` associated with a target. This
|
|
|
+ property supports
|
|
|
+ :manual:`generator expressions <cmake-generator-expressions(7)>`.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+:prop_tgt:`INCLUDE_DIRECTORIES`
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 If the ``TYPE`` is ``HEADERS``, and the scope of the file set is ``PRIVATE``
|
|
|
+ or ``PUBLIC``, all of the ``BASE_DIRS`` of the file set are wrapped in
|
|
|
+ :genex:`$<BUILD_INTERFACE>` and appended to this property.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+:prop_tgt:`INTERFACE_INCLUDE_DIRECTORIES`
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 If the ``TYPE`` is ``HEADERS``, and the scope of the file set is
|
|
|
+ ``INTERFACE`` or ``PUBLIC``, all of the ``BASE_DIRS`` of the file set are
|
|
|
+ wrapped in :genex:`$<BUILD_INTERFACE>` and appended to this property.
